Mission accomplished for Chievo Verona winning the home game at the Marc’Antonio Bentegodi Stadium against Cagliari. Chievo was -1 point below Cagliari before the game and this victory puts Chievo with 18 points ahead of Cagliari. It’s a boost for the morale of the team winning their 5th game this season.
Chievo Verona opening the score in the 53rd minute. It is midfielder Massimo Gobbi to score defeating Cagliari goalkeeper Marco Storari with a left footed shot in the bottom left corner. The assist is by Lucas Castro.

2016 – 2017 Italian Serie A Week 13
Chievo Verona 1 – 0 Cagliari
Saturday 19 November 2016
Marc’Antonio Bentegodi Stadium
Verona, Italy
15:00
Referee: GAVILLUCCI
Assistants: DOBOSZ – PRENNA
Fourth Official: TOLFO
ADD1: PAIRETTO
ADD2: DI PAOLO
Goals: 53′ Massimo Gobbi (Ch)
Official lineups – formations:
CHIEVO VERONA (4-3-1-2): Sorrentino; Cacciatore, Gamberini, Spolli, Gobbi; Izco, Radovanović, Castro; de Guzmán; Pellissier, Floro Flores.
Subs: Seculin, Confente, Frey, Sardo, Cesar, Costa, N. Rigoni, Parigini, Meggiorini, Inglese, Jallow.
Coach: Rolando Maran.
CAGLIARI (4-3-1-2): Storari; Ceppitelli, Salamon, B. Alves, Bittante; Barella, Munari, Padoin; Di Gennaro; Farias, Giannetti.
Subs: Rafael, Colombo, Briukhov, Oliveira, Isla, Biancu, Melchiorri, Sau, Borriello.
Coach: Rastelli.
Booked: Bittante, Radovanovic, Ceppitelli, Spolli, Munari, Cacciatore
